Paxton Carl Is Here!

Things have been busy around here! About a week and a half ago, Paxton Carl, decided to make an early appearance! On Sept 15th, I got up and noticed around 8am that I was having some contractions every ten minutes or so that were a little stronger then my normal Braxton Hicks. I think I might have been in denial because I waited till 11:30 to call the doctor. And even then, it took some convincing from my mom and sister that I was in labor. The contractions were not consistent and kept varying from 5-15 mins apart. I tried drinking water, laying down, and taking a bath but nothing seemed to make them quit. I of course was thinking- I am not ready for this...he is not suppose to be here for another week! My bag wasn't packed, my house wasn't cleaned, I hadn't made it to the grocery store, and my toes were looking forward to a pedicure. But Paxton had other plans. Once we got to the hospital, Vim told them I was in labor and I told the nurse to not put me in a Labor and Delivery room but to put me in a Observation room because I wasn't really in labor (still in denial). It wasn't until the nurse said that my contractions were about 5 mins apart and they were not going to send me home did it really start to set in that I was going to have a baby soon. Within an hour all grandparents appeared. I had to have a c-section since Vimmer was an emergency c-section. I have to say, this time around it was much more enjoyable.
